    Is there a way to stop preinstalled Apps from using up my monthly Metered Data allowance?


    In Settings > Apps > Apps & Features there are several preinstalled Apps listed that I will never use. These Apps use an amount of my Data each month, and I believe that I am not able to uninstall them.


    In the Screen Shot below, you will see an example of “Email accounts” using 11 MB of Data. I do not consciously use this App as my e-mails from my btinterent.com account are viewed via M.S. Outlook.



    Unwanted Apps Using Data [​IMG]
    Data Usage 310518 sized
    by Philip Mock, on Flickr

    This is what I have done so far regarding trying to stop “Email accounts” from using my Metered Data:



    • In Network & Internet, I have “Set as metered connection” turned ON.

    • I used PowerShell with the following command in an attempt to disable “Email accounts” from my computer;
    Get-AppxPackage *microsoft.windowscommunicationsapps_17.9029.21675.0_x64__8wekyb3d8bbwe* | Remove-AppxPackage

    Sadly, the App is still listed in Data Usage, and consumes some of my monthly Metered Data.


    There are other Apps listed in the screen shot that I do not consciously use, which I would also like to block from using my Metered Data such as Cortana & Microsoft Edge - if it is at all possible to disable them.

    Try the following steps and check if it helps:

    Step 1:

    I suggest you reset the Windows Sockets and check.

    Follow the below steps:

    • Right click on the Start button and click
      Command Prompt (Admin).
    • In the Command Prompt, type the following command, and then press
      ENTER:
    netsh winsock reset

    If the issue persists then follow the below step.

    Step 2:

    I suggest you reset the Windows firewall and check.

    Follow the below steps:

    • Right click on the Start button and click
      Command Prompt (Admin).
    • In the Command Prompt, type the following command, and then press
      ENTER:
    netsh firewall reset

    If the issue persists then follow the below step.

    Step 3:

    I suggest you to disable proxy and check.

    Follow the below steps:

    • Press Windows + R keys from the keyboard.
    • Type inetcpl.cpl and hit Enter.
    • Click the Connections tab, and then click LAN settings.
    • Uncheck mark the Use a proxy server for your LAN check box.
